Reducing Mutual Coupling in Microstrip Array Antenna Using Metamaterial Spiral Resonator


Mohammad Ali Mansouri-Birjandi and Hamideh Kondori

Abstract— Utilization of metamaterial structures has been becoming attractive in the community of electromagnetic and antenna. In this paper, a metamaterial spiral resonator (SR) is proposed as an effective solution for reducing mutual coupling in a microstrip array antenna that consists of two elements. Applying the proposed periodic structure in the substrate and between the patches is simulated and studied. Simulation results show the improvement of mutual coupling and return loss by adding spiral resonator structure to the antenna substrate.

Keywords: Microstrip array antenna, Mutual coupling, Metamaterial, Spiral resonator

ABOUT THE AUTHORS

Mohammad Ali Mansouri-Birjandi
Mohammad Ali Mansouri-Birjandi received his BSc and MSc degrees in electrical engineering from the University of Sistan and Baluchestan, Iran and the University of Tehran, Iran in 1986 and 1991, respectively. He then joined the University of Sistan and Baluchestan, Iran. In 2008, he obtained his PhD degree in electrical engineering from Trabiat Modares University, Iran.As an assistant professor at the University of Sistan and Baluchestan, his research areas are photonics, optoelectronics, analog integrated circuits, and metamaterial. Dr. Mansouri has served as a reviewer for a number of journals and conferences.

Hamideh Kondori
Hamideh Kondori obtained her BSc and MSc degrees in electrical engineering from the University of Sistan and Baluchestan, Iran in 2008 and 2011, respectively. Her areas of research include microstrip patch and planar metamaterial antenna, electromagnetic band gap and photonic crystal structures.
